Coreldraw Macros Fixed ★ Proven
Whether you are dealing with broken VBA code, compatibility issues after an upgrade, or permission errors, this comprehensive guide will help you get your CorelDRAW macros fixed and running smoothly again. Common Reasons Why CorelDRAW Macros Break
Ensure your security level is set to "Medium" or "Low" (use caution) to allow macros to run. coreldraw macros fixed
Move the GlobalMacros.gms file to your desktop (as a backup) and restart CorelDRAW. Whether you are dealing with broken VBA code,
Fixed Code: Declare PtrSafe Sub MyFunction Lib "user32" (ByVal avg As LongPtr) 5. Reset CorelDRAW Workspace to Defaults Fixed Code: Declare PtrSafe Sub MyFunction Lib "user32"
Your macros worked perfectly in older (32-bit) versions of CorelDRAW but fail with error messages like "The code in this project must be updated for use on 64-bit systems" when you upgrade to a newer 64-bit version.
Perform the actions you want to automate (e.g., placing guidelines, importing a logo). Go to > Scripts > Stop Recording . ⌨️ Step 2: Assign a Shortcut Run your "fixed" task instantly with a hotkey. Go to Tools > Options > Customization (or Commands ). Select Macros from the dropdown list. Find your macro in the list.
This file becomes corrupted when multiple VBA-enabled applications interact. Deleting it resolves the crash, though you may need to delete it again periodically.